A cement mill (or finish mill in North American usage) is the equipment used to grind the hard nodular clinker from the cement kiln into the fine grey powder that is cement Most cement is currently ground in ball mills and also vertical roller mills which are more effective than ball mills

Vertical mixers are the most common type found in small livestock feed mills However the vertical type is less well suited to aquaculture poultry and fish feeds than the horizontal type which are much more efficient in blending in small quantities of liquids (such as added lipids) or in mixing ingredients with different particle sizes

The former milling technology yields whole meal which contains both the bran and germ while the latter one yields a large range of products including partly or fully de-germed meals called respectively bolted and super-sifted meals The production of whole meal is carried out in three types of mills plate stone and hammer mills

Milling is the process of machining using rotary cutters to remove material by advancing a cutter into a workpiece This may be done varying direction on one or several axes cutter head speed and pressure Milling covers a wide variety of different operations and machines on scales from small individual parts to large heavy-duty gang milling operations

The vertical axis design was popular during the early development of the windmill However its inefficiency of operation led to the development of the numerous horizontal axis designs Of the horizontal axes versions there are a variety of these including the post mill smock mill tower mill and the fan mill

Stirred Mills have been proven to provide energy savings compared with traditional ball mills The finer the product required the more efficient stirred mills will be than a ball mill The attrition grinding action vertical arrangement and the finer media size distribution contribute to make stirred mills more energy efficient grinding machines

Screen Design The amount of open area in a hammer mill screen determines the particle size and grinding efficiency The screen must be designed to maintain its integrity and provide the greatest amount of open area Screen openings (holes) that are aligned in a 60-degree staggered pattern optimise open area while maintaining screen strength
